Williamsburg- Phyllis Margaret Begunck was born on March 3rd, 1943, near Marengo, Iowa to Ralph James and Alma Emilia Mae (Weisskopf) Heitman. She graduated from Williamsburg High School in 1961 and attended Ellsworth Community College before attaining her her BA in Library Education from State College of Iowa (later named the University of Northern Iowa) in 1966. She worked as a school librarian in Spencer, Everly and South Clay schools for over 24 years. On February 24th, 1968, Phyllis was united in marriage to Marvin Fred Bjork at Trinity United Church of Christ, near Marengo. She lived in Ames, Spencer and later Williamsburg. Marvin passed away in 2001 and Phyllis married Henry Edwin Begunck at Trinity United Church of Christ on June 18, 2005. Phyllis was a member of the United Church of Christ. She enjoyed her cats, playing cards with her ladies group and the church group, volunteering in care centers with Ed to play piano for the residents, singing in the church choir and with the Believers community chorus of Marengo. Phyllis passed on Monday, March 16th, 2026, at Mercy Hospital in Cedar Rapids, at the age of 83.
She is survived by her husband, Ed, of Williamsburg; two children Scott (Sarah Radermacher) Bjork of Marshall, Minnesota and Andrea (John) Todsen of Ankeny; four grandchildren Alex, Anna, Aubrey and Gavin; and three sisters Joan Hunt of Blakesburg, Zelda Sherman of Ely and Alice White of Ankeny. She was preceded by her parents; her first husband Marvin; and five siblings Raymond Heitman, John Heitman, Karen Ramsey, Linda Roberts and Wayne Heitman.
